Description
Clip 27 - Color 1962 / Trip to Denver for Convention / Salt Lake City / Seattle World's Fair Berthoud Pass Lodge; Poudre Lake; City Park; Temple Square; Mrs. Roeding and one of her sons; Seattle World's Fair;
Box says "Rocky National Park and Seattle Fair; August 1962"
